Background
The circuit protection mainly protects components in an electronic circuit from being damaged under the conditions of overvoltage, overcurrent, surge, electromagnetic interference and the like, along with the development of science and technology, power/electronic products are increasingly diversified and complicated, the applied circuit protection element is a simple glass tube fuse in the non-exion day, and the common protection element is a piezoresistor, a TVS, a gas discharge tube and the like, so that the circuit protection element has been developed into a new type of various emerging electronic element fields.
When electronic components such as a plug-in unit and a resistor are welded on the conventional circuit board, the resistor and the plug-in unit are required to be plugged into the circuit board, then the resistor and the plug-in unit are welded by turning over the circuit board, and the resistor, the plug-in unit and the like can be easily loosened and moved when the circuit board is turned over, so that the circuit board fails to be installed.

Referring to fig. 1-4, the present utility model provides a technical solution: the utility model provides a frequency conversion circuit protection plug-in components, includes circuit board 1, resistance 2 and plug-in components 3, and the top left side of circuit board 1 is provided with resistance 2, and the top right side of circuit board 1 is provided with plug-in components 3, and frequency conversion circuit protection plug-in components still includes: the overturning member 4 is rotatably arranged at the bottom end of the circuit board 1; the limiting member 5 is rotatably arranged at the left side of the overturning member 4; the overturning component 4 is used for driving the circuit board 1 to overturn, and the limiting component 5 is used for limiting the circuit board 1.
Specifically, the flipping member 4 includes: the device comprises a supporting frame 401, a rotating rod 402, a limiting button 403, a supporting rod 404 and a pressing plate 405;
The support 401 is arranged at the bottom end of the circuit board 1; the rotating rod 402 is rotatably arranged inside the top end of the supporting frame 401; the limiting button 403 is rotatably arranged on the front surface of the supporting frame 401, and the limiting button 403 is used for limiting the rotating rod 402; the supporting rod 404 is fixedly arranged at the left side of the top end of the rotating rod 402, and the supporting rod 404 is used for supporting the pressing plate 405; the pressing plate 405 is rotatably arranged on the inner side of the supporting rod 404, and the pressing plate 405 is used for limiting the circuit board 1; wherein, support frame 401 is used for supporting bull stick 402, and bull stick 402 is used for supporting circuit board 1, and the bottom of clamp plate 405 is provided with the foam-rubber cushion and is used for preventing to crush electronic component, and the back outer wall of spacing button 403 is provided with the screw thread and is used for driving spacing button 403 backward movement and carries out spacing to bull stick 402, and the right side of bull stick 402 is seted up flutedly.
More specifically, the stopper member 5 includes: a stay 501, a cross plate 502, a slide bar 503 and a press block 504;
The stay 501 is rotatably arranged on the right side of the rotating rod 402; the transverse plate 502 is fixedly arranged at the top end of the stay bar 501; the sliding rod 503 is slidably arranged in the transverse plate 502, and the sliding rod 503 is used for driving the pressing block 504 to move up and down; the pressing block 504 is fixedly arranged at the bottom end of the sliding rod 503, and the pressing block 504 is used for limiting the pressing plate 405; wherein, the stay 501 is used for supporting diaphragm 502, and diaphragm 502 is used for supporting slide bar 503, and the inside of briquetting 504 and diaphragm 502 is provided with the spring and is used for restoring to the throne briquetting 504.
